Summary: Replace some old code that probably pre-dated the change to delay emission of dllexported code until after the closing brace of the outermost record type. Only uninstantiated default argument expressions need to be handled now. It is enough to instantiate default argument expressions when instantiating dllexported default ctors. This also fixes some double-diagnostic issues in this area. Fixes PR31500 Reviewers: rsmith Subscribers: cfe-commits Differential Revision: https://reviews.llvm.org/D28274 llvm-svn: 291045
